    Traffic restoration over Takaka Hill is on track to be completed in time for Christmas


    The Transport Agency says work to repair storm-damaged sites on State Highway 60 at the top of the South Island, is progressing well - and the two lane road will be open and resealed before the summer holidays.

    Nelson Tasman System Manager Rob Service says they've used local contractors with local knowledge of the route and previous construction designs, to turn a 12-month job into a six-month one.

    He says they're building back at pace and adding extra resilience to help future-proof the roads against weather-related damage in the future.
